Hi, I have a temperature gauge in my dials, but it's not working.

I have found that there is only 1 wire going to it at the back, and that is the ignition live.

The other wires do not seem to be anywhere to be found behind the gauges.

Is the gauge a Celcius, or Fahrenheit gauge?

If it is a Celcius one then I have a spare vdo dipstick sensor I could use to wire it up.

If it's a Fahrenheit one I need to try and find where the wire from the sensor on the bottom of the engine is going to, but without a ramp that could be tricky.

You are in luck since the oil temperature feed wire is all on its own in the engine bay so easy to find. Find the branch of the harness with fat red wires that heads to the battery and it is half way along that, green with black tracer.

It goes through the main harness like all the other wires so must be behind the dash somewhere.
